01 Yukon XL Lift?
I have a 01 Yukon XL. I want to go move up to a BFG 285 All Terrain Tire. I know that I will need to add a spacer to push the wheel away from the shock mounts, due to increased width. I am also wanting to give my truck a small lift. Someone suggested turning my torsion bars in the front and adding a poly spacers in the rear. Is this the right thing to do, or should does anyone have a better solution. All comments appreciated.

Re: 01 Yukon XL Lift?
torsion bar turning is ok, I did it, then I wanted more so I got a 6inch lift, i suggest looking into about a 2-3in lift if you only want a lil bit, plus then you could fit like 305s on it, at 6in i can fit 315s. The torsions will only take the front up (no more than level is suggested) about .25 of an inch...
